Normal blood pressure is recognized today much like normal body weight in the sense that the defining level is that which is associated with the greatest chance of life expectancy. In other words, this is the pressure at which the heart and other important parts of the body such as the circulatory system are able to operate under the hardest conditions without the risk of heart disease and associated conditions.

Naturally there are a number of other factors that have to be taken into observation when defining high blood pressure and some of these have to be excluded. For instance, If a healthy person gets their systolic (or pumping) blood pressure to rise it will rise by possibly as much as fifty percent as their blood flow increases in response to emotional excitement or any form of energetic exercise. However it will not remain high for long and once the level of excitement has gone down your blood pressure also falls back to normal.

As well as a systolic (pumping) pressure you also have a diastolic (relaxed) pressure which is the more important of the two and is a very good guide in determining whether or not a high reading is a false positive. The reason why the diastolic pressure is important is because it points to the state of a person’s arteries and a high reading might mean that the arteries are constricted and not allowing the free flow of blood as they should be.

It is very important to understand that high blood pressure is not a disease in itself but is a value by which doctors can predict other conditions.

Finally, it is also very important to realize that high blood pressure cannot be cured although it can be very well controlled and maintained.
